Art & Soul is a fully illustrated book of poetry, with every poem accompanied by an original watercolour by 15-year-old artist Bethia Erin Rose. The poetry by Anna Erika Springett is arranged in three chapters, which in turn explore the ideas of Courage, Kindness, and Curiosity, what it means to live with (and sometimes without) these qualities, and how it feels to move towards and embrace each of them.

Every poem has been written from real, lived human experience, be that the author's own and those observed or shared with her by others. Each section is full of heart and soul, both deep-diving and lightly-treading: What does it mean to be brave, have a voice, feel difficult emotion? How can I unreservedly express kindness to myself, others, and the earth? What are the questions I dare to ask, the edges I might move towards? How can I cultivate a truly open mind and heart?

Poetry has the power to connect us tenderly with our own human experience, enabling access to parts of ourselves that are inviting attention. The author's hope is that the three sections of Courage, Kindness and Curiosity will support the reader as an individual on their own path of discovery, as well as providing a resource for professionals working with clients in coaching, therapy or supervision.
